Why Waterbury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ist
Waterbury's housing stock is incredibly diverse. You've got century-old Victorians near the green, post-war Cape Cods throughout the residential streets, and newer construction in the surrounding hills. Each type of home comes with different garage door configurations, and what works for a 1920s carriage house conversion won't work for a 1990s colonial with a two-car attached garage.
The weather here doesn't do garage doors any favors either. Connecticut winters mean freeze-thaw cycles that wreak havoc on springs and cables. Most torsion springs last 7 to 9 years, not the 10 that manufacturers claim, especially with our temperature swings. When moisture gets into your opener's circuit board during humid summers, you're looking at electrical issues that show up as intermittent operation or complete failure.
We see a lot of roller wear in Waterbury because of the hilly terrain. Homes on slopes put extra stress on certain components. If your door feels heavier on one side or makes grinding noises, it's usually the rollers or the vertical track alignment. These aren't problems you should ignore because they lead to cable failures, and a snapped cable can trash your door panels in seconds.
What We Do for Waterbury Homeowners
Our spring replacement service is what we do most often in Waterbury. When a torsion spring breaks, your door isn't opening, period. We carry high-cycle springs rated for 25,000 operations, which outlast the standard 10,000-cycle springs most builders install. The job typically takes 45 minutes to an hour, and we always replace both springs even if only one broke. The second one is on borrowed time anyway.
Opener installation is another big request.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models, and we'll walk you through which features actually matter. Belt drive openers run quieter (important if you have bedrooms above the garage), while chain drive models cost less and handle heavier doors better. Battery backup is worth it in Waterbury because power outages happen, especially during ice storms.
Cable and roller repairs often get overlooked until something dramatic happens. Frayed cables should be replaced immediately. We also handle full door replacements when repair costs don't make sense anymore. If your door has significant panel damage, rust issues, or is just outdated, we can measure and install a new one within a week of approval. What brands of garage door openers do you recommend?
LiftMaster is our top recommendation for reliability and parts availability. Chamberlain (same parent company) offers good value for tighter budgets. Genie models work well too. We don't push the most expensive model unless you actually need commercial-grade features. Most homeowners do fine with a mid-range belt or chain drive opener with basic smart features.
How much does spring replacement cost in Waterbury?
Most spring replacements run between $225 and $350 depending on door size and spring type. Two-car doors cost more than single-car doors because they need larger springs. High-cycle springs add to the cost but last two to three times longer. We give exact quotes over the phone once we know your door specifications. You can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
